  elf
     n.
     1 (lb en Norse mythology) A luminous spirit presiding over nature and
  fertility and dwelling in the world of Álfheim (Elfland). Compare angel,
  nymph, fairy.
     2 Any from a race of mythical, supernatural beings resembling but
  seen as distinct from human beings. They are usually delicate-featured
  and skilled in magic or spellcrafting; sometimes depicted as clashing
  with dwarves, especially in modern fantasy literature.
     3 (lb en fantasy) Any of the magical, typically forest-guarding races
  bearing some similarities to the Norse álfar (through Tolkien's Eldar).
     4 A very diminutive person; a dwarf<ref>(R:Webster
  1913)</ref>.
     5 (lb en South Africa) The bluefish (''Pomatomus saltatrix'').
     vb.
     (lb en now rare) To twist into elflocks (of hair); to mat.
